गृहपृष्ठ ∕ Business ∕ Gold price up by Rs 2,900 per tola Business Gold price up by Rs 2,900 per tola KathmanduPati June 03, 2025 KATHMANDU – The price of gold and silver has increased in the domestic market today. Gold is being traded at Rs 192,700 per tola (11.66 grams). According to the Federation of Nepal Gold and Silver Dealers’ Association, the price of gold has climbed by Rs 2,900 per tola today as compared to Monday. Similarly, the Federation has fixed the price of silver at Rs 2,045 per tola today. The price of gold has been determined at 3,376 US dollar per ounce in the international market today.
